hawker
Meanings
Plural: hawkers
Noun
- someone who travels about selling his wares (as on the streets or at carnivals)
- a person who breeds and trains hawks and who follows the sport of falconry
- A peddler, a huckster, a person who sells easily transportable goods.
- Any dragonfly of the family Aeshnidae; a darner.
- A seller of food in a hawker centre.
- Someone who breeds and trains hawks and other falcons; a falconer.
Origin / Etymology
Probably Borrowed from Low German or Dutch, from Middle Low German hoker and ultimately from the root of huckster.
